Platform: Game Boy Advance
Publisher: Nintendo of America, Inc.
Release Date: Feb 2006
Rating: Everyone
UPC: 045496736897
Product ID: EPID50407121

  Lots of fun
Review created: 05/13/09

There were a lot of obscure titles on the GBA that unfortunately went by the wayside. This was one of them. Drill Dozer is a fun game about Jill, a woman who drives this huge mechanical suit(kind of like Tron Bronne from the Mega Man Series) who has this giant drill that you upgrade throughout each level with gears. This gameplay mechanic can be used in a variety of ways, drilling up, down, into gelatinous blocks to leap longer distances, and of course destroying enemy bosses. For an obscure title, this is a great deal of fun, and I highly recommend it.

  I DIG THIS!
Review created: 03/20/09
by:

Drill Dozer, a title by Game Freak (The company made famous for its Pokemon games) that never caught on, which is sad because it's certainly more fun than most other games I've played. Ken Sugimori (Made famous for designing Pikachu and all those other Pokemon characters, including the humans) provides character designs here. I recommend this to anyone.

(Note: If you played Smash Bros Brawl, you should recognize Jill (the main character of Drill Dozer) for she was an assist trophy in Brawl.)

  Drill Dozer -- Best game ever?? PERHAPS SO!!
Review created: 09/08/08
by:

Drill Dozer is an action game of the same ilk as Super Mario World, but with puzzle situations that remind me of the Zelda series. You play as Jill, a bombastic 12-year-old and daughter of Doug, the leader of a band of good-hearted thieves. When Doug is mugged and his precious Red Diamond stolen, Jill dons her robotic Drill Dozer suit to fight the evil Skullker gang to get it back! This game has it all--great action, creative levels, fun characters, a simple yet entertaining plot, plenty of secrets, and an awesome theme. You'll find yourself using the drill to climb elevators, activate machines, defeat bad guys, and of course dig. The game reeks of style, I mean, it even comes with a little comic book to give you more of the characters. I love this game, in case you can't tell.
